on the other hand, Why is my GE washer leaking from the bottom?

The drain pump pumps water out the drain hose. If the drain pump is cracked or damaged, or if the bearings are worn out, the drain pump may leak water. The tub seal might be torn, causing water to leak from the seal. …

How much does it cost to replace a lid switch on a washer?

Washer Lid Switch Repair Cost

If the switch on your washing machine lid is broken, the washer probably isn’t recognizing that the door is closed and won’t start the cycle. Replacing a switch for a washer isn’t costly and runs between $90 and $150.

How much does it cost to fix a leaking washing machine?

The overall cost to repair a washing machine averages $150 to $300 . The average homeowner pays $200 for fixing a bad seal or faulty water level switch, both common problems.

Can a leaking washer be repaired?

Issue #1.

If a gasket has worn spots, leaking will occur. Typically, you can solve the problem easily — take the front cover of the washer off and tighten the bolts to make the gasket sit better. If the damage is more extensive, replacing faulty washer equipment is the most reasonable option.

How do I know if my washing machine lid switch is bad?

The lid switch ensures that the washer door is closed while the washer is spinning. If the lid switch is broken, the washer will not spin. If the washer won’t spin but will still agitate, the lid switch is likely defective.

What does a washer lid switch do?

Your washing machine has a small switch that engages when you close the washing machine lid. This little switch was added to prevent injuries that used to be sustained by people who reached in the washing machine while it was operating.
